Twitter - Million Dollar Chinks in Big Tech's Armour? BusinessGuest User25 September 2019Twitter, Social Media, Twitter $418 million in losses, Twitter IPO, Twitter pre tax losses, Jack Dorsey, Noah Glass, Twitter Launch